Vall de Cardós ( Catalan pronunciation: [ˈbaʎ ðe kaɾˈðos]) is a village in the province of Lleida and autonomous community of Catalonia, Spain. It is part of the province Pallars Sobirà and has a population of 388 (register office, 2025) .
